> "Published specification:" - I would make these pointers to Sections 2 and 3
> of draft-levine-application-gzip; referencing the base specs directly here
> would mean that draft-levine-application-gzip doesn't get referenced in the
> media types registry at all.

I think it's OK the way it is.  Look at RFC 3778 which defines 
application/pdf.  Its published spec is the Adobe reference books, but the 
media registry entry refers to the RFC.  Most RFCs that register media 
types also define the media so they point to themselves, but the few that 
don't point to the base specs.
